Program Highlights:

Biodiversity Monitoring:
Participate in biodiversity monitoring activities to assess and document the flora and fauna in conservation areas. Use various techniques, such as camera traps and field surveys, to gather valuable data.

Habitat Restoration:
Contribute to habitat restoration projects aimed at preserving and enhancing the natural environments of endangered species. Participate in tree planting initiatives and invasive species control.

Community Education and Outreach:
Engage with local communities to raise awareness about wildlife conservation. Conduct educational workshops and outreach programs to promote conservation ethics.

Wildlife conservation volunteer program

Anti-Poaching Initiatives:
Collaborate with conservation professionals to support anti-poaching efforts. Assist in implementing strategies to mitigate the impact of poaching on wildlife populations.

Wildlife Research:
Assist in wildlife research projects, focusing on specific species or ecosystems. Contribute to ongoing research that informs conservation policies and practices.
